Fix swiping up to Overview in landscape mode
Bug: 121280703 Change-Id: I9802c6f547a592be891e7c4f5e8db8dadaa0425d Tests: TaplTests, locally modified to force Landscape
This commit is contained in:
parent
d182943d3d
commit
44ecb9d7cb
|
@ -344,7 +344,8 @@ public class TouchInteractionService extends Service {
|
||||||
startTouchTracking(ev, true /* updateLocationOffset */);
|
startTouchTracking(ev, true /* updateLocationOffset */);
|
||||||
break;
|
break;
|
||||||
case ACTION_MOVE: {
|
case ACTION_MOVE: {
|
||||||
float displacement = ev.getY() - mDownPos.y;
|
float displacement = mActivity.getDeviceProfile().isLandscape ?
|
||||||
|
ev.getX() - mDownPos.x : ev.getY() - mDownPos.y;
|
||||||
if (Math.abs(displacement) >= mTouchSlop) {
|
if (Math.abs(displacement) >= mTouchSlop) {
|
||||||
// Start tracking only when mTouchSlop is crossed.
|
// Start tracking only when mTouchSlop is crossed.
|
||||||
startTouchTracking(ev, true /* updateLocationOffset */);
|
startTouchTracking(ev, true /* updateLocationOffset */);
|
||||||
|
|
Loading…
Reference in New Issue